1. Understand Different Types of Hydraulic Pumps
Before choosing a supplier, buyers should understand the main categories of hydraulic pumps and their applications.
1.1 Hydraulic Gear Pumps
Hydraulic gear pumps are among the most widely used hydraulic pumps because of their simple structure, high reliability, and cost efficiency.
A gear pump works by using two rotating gears to transport hydraulic oil from the inlet side to the outlet side. The continuous rotation creates hydraulic flow and pressure.
Main advantages:
- Simple and compact design
- High durability
- Easy maintenance
- Cost-effective solution
- Suitable for mobile hydraulic equipment
Typical applications include:
- Construction machinery
- Agricultural machinery
- Forklifts
- Dump trucks
- Material handling equipment
- Hydraulic power units
A reliable hydraulic gear pump supplier should provide different displacement options, mounting configurations, shaft designs, and pressure ratings to meet various machine requirements.
1.2 Hydraulic Piston Pumps
Hydraulic piston pumps are designed for applications requiring high pressure and high efficiency.
Compared with gear pumps, piston pumps can operate under higher pressure conditions and provide better energy efficiency.
Common types include:
- Axial piston pumps
- Radial piston pumps
- Variable displacement piston pumps
- Fixed displacement piston pumps
They are commonly used in:
- Excavators
- Mining machinery
- Concrete pumps
- Hydraulic presses
- Heavy-duty industrial equipment

1.3 Hydraulic Motors
Hydraulic motors convert hydraulic energy into mechanical rotary power.
A complete hydraulic system requires both pumps and motors to achieve efficient energy transmission.
Common hydraulic motor types include:
- Hydraulic gear motors
- Orbital motors
- Radial piston motors
- Axial piston motors
Hydraulic motors are widely used in:
- Wheel drives
- Winch systems
- Conveyor systems
- Agricultural machinery
- Mining vehicles

3. Evaluate Manufacturing Capability and Quality Control
Product quality is one of the most important factors when selecting a hydraulic pump manufacturer.
A professional manufacturer should have:
Advanced Production Equipment
Modern CNC machines, machining centers, and automated production lines help ensure:
- Accurate dimensions
- Stable quality
- Consistent performance
Strict Quality Inspection
Hydraulic components require precise manufacturing because even small machining errors can affect:
- Internal leakage
- Volumetric efficiency
- Operating noise
- Service life
Important testing processes include:
- Pressure testing
- Flow testing
- Leakage inspection
- Performance testing
Before shipment, every hydraulic pump should be checked carefully to ensure it meets customer requirements.
4. Consider OEM and Replacement Capability
Many customers need replacement hydraulic pumps for existing equipment.
A good hydraulic supplier should understand not only product manufacturing but also replacement applications.
For example, customers may need alternatives for:
- Rexroth hydraulic pumps
- Parker hydraulic pumps
- Sauer Danfoss pumps
- Caterpillar hydraulic pumps
- Komatsu hydraulic pumps
- Volvo hydraulic pumps
A professional supplier should help customers identify:
- Pump model
- Displacement
- Mounting type
- Shaft specification
- Rotation direction
- Pressure rating
Correct replacement selection can significantly reduce machine downtime.
